As a former student of Karate World in Suwanee, Georgia, I have nothing but positive experiences to mention. In the eleven years that I was at Karate World, I have changed completely. Often times students of leadership forget the roots of their learning in the midst of cramming several different lessons throughout the course of leadership enlightenment. I am fortunate enough to say that I remember the location of my initial foundation of such learning. I came to Karate World around the age of five and had a definite fear of other people. I hardly talked to anyone. Time passed, and as I grew older, I became more open to the people around me; however, I was not a true extrovert until one day in leadership class (Leader Quest). I was around the age of eleven, and Master St. James had picked a new exercise to teach us about public speaking. He claimed the rules were very simple: one of us had to come up to the front of our class, speak for five minutes extemporaneously on a topic that he would choose, and eschew the two phrases "like" and "um". He would then sit in the back of the room, and keep count of each time those words were repeated. Master St. James asked for volunteers, but no one volunteered themselves. The unresponsiveness of the class prompted Master St. James to "volunteer" someone himself. The lucky person just so happened to be me. I ambled to the front of the classroom, reluctant to torture the class with my stumbling words. Master St. James gave me the dreaded topic of talking about myself for five minutes (Trust me, giving biographical information about one's self for five minutes is easier said than done). After choking out the first two sentences that sounded as if I was speaking in a foreign language, I gained confidence. It was after those two initial sentences that I realized that I enjoyed speaking to the general public, and that I should no longer hide my true self from anyone.
It was with this type of leadership training that I molded my the first stepping stone of future. I had to opportunity to join the Gwinnett Student Leadership Team, and further cultivate the initial teachings of the Karate World Leadership Team. I have been able to speak to different groups of people, with varying ages. I am entering college at the George Washington University this fall, and I do not fear for one second that I will not succeed. Master St. James and Leader Quest have given me all the tools necessary for success in any part of this world.
